[PATCH v2 3/4] bootconfig: Skip internal tree sanity checks in kernel

In xbc_verify_tree(), the loop iterating through all nodes to check that
xbc_nodes[i].next < xbc_node_num and xbc_nodes[i].child < xbc_node_num
is a defensive sanity check against implementation regressions (such
an out-of-bounds index cannot be produced by malformed input).

Running this check in the kernel adds unnecessary boot-time overhead.
Split this check out into xbc_sanity_check_tree() for userspace, so
that it continues to run during userspace bootconfig validation (e.g.
when applying or testing bootconfig with tools/bootconfig), but is
omitted in the kernel to speed up initialization.
